Output 2e8d868dcea8c6a7091589fd3472cbe2302e8679735e5fe0c30ad5b57fa17212:1

value
27118322
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e6caa28918e7b16a72b93dc6d88134e415317400 OP_EQUAL
address
3NjL5z4upCbwC6HfEAgfm2i4b8PaSQoUkd
transaction
2e8d868dcea8c6a7091589fd3472cbe2302e8679735e5fe0c30ad5b57fa17212
spent
true